Transaction fbe06f39bd2dca8a347934b559b6e96b9845453e95ccfed97c74f1f50c405789
2 Input
2 Outputs
- fbe06f39bd2dca8a347934b559b6e96b9845453e95ccfed97c74f1f50c405789:0
- fbe06f39bd2dca8a347934b559b6e96b9845453e95ccfed97c74f1f50c405789:1
value 45092
address 1JDggUvTYk3C5wXz7YgqgZuEpAfLuRJJXe
value 23127640
address 38yD9pXMcBUFLFPqyKSTLMZ4Sy56BgEbek